Rat auditory pathway schematic KubkeM Fabiana WildJ Martin 2018 <div><p>Schematic of the auditory pathway showing ascending (<b>A</b>) and descending (<b>B</b>) projections (based on Malmierca, 2003). Projections from the ear and <a>cochlear</a><a href="#_msocom_1">[plw1]</a> nucleus complex are shown in <i>black</i>; superior olivary complex in <i>blue</i>; nuclei of the lateral lemniscus in <i>green tones</i>; inferior colliculus in <a><i>orange</i></a><i> tones</i><a href="#_msocom_2">[plw2]</a> , auditory thalamus in <i>purple tones</i> and auditory cortex in <i>red tones</i>. <i>Dotted lines</i> represent known inhibitory projections. <a><i>Abbreviations</i></a><a href="#_msocom_3">[plw3]</a> : CIC: central nucleus of the inferior colliculus; DCIC: dorsal cortex of the inferior colliculus; DCN: dorsal cochlear nucleus; DNLL: dorsal nucleus of the lateral lemniscus; ECIC: external cortex of the inferior colliculus; INVN: interstitial nucleus of the vestibulocochlear nerve; LNTB: lateral nucleus of the trapezoid body ; LSO: lateral superior olive; MGD: dorsal subdivision of the medial geniculate body; MGM: medial subdivision of the medial geniculate body; MGV: ventral subdivision of the medial geniculate body; MNTB: medial nucleus of the trapezoid body; MSO: medial superior olive; PIL: posterior intralaminar nucleus; PP: peripendicular nucleus; PRN: pontine reticular nucleus; Rt: reticular thalamic nucleus; SPON: superior paraolivary nucleus;Te1: primary auditory cortex ; Te2: caudal auditory field; Te3: rostroventral auditory field; VCN: ventral cochlear nucleus; VNLL: ventral nucleus of the lateral lemniscus; VNTB: ventral nucleus of the trapezoid body.</p></div>
